Game Recap: Women's Volleyball | | Samantha Traini, Interim Director of Strategic Communications and Ideation

IUP volleyball's remarkable offensive performance led to three set sweep

CALIFORNIA, Pa. – The IUP Crimson Hawks had a commanding performance against Cal U, securing a 3-0 victory with set scores of 25-12, 25-17, and 25-13. This win improves IUP's record to 12-6 overall and 2-2 in PSAC play, while Cal U falls to 3-11 and 0-5 in the conference.

IUP dominated in several statistical categories, boasting a significant 45-15 advantage in kills and a total points margin of 62-21. The Crimson Hawks showcased their offensive abilities with a hitting percentage of .250, while Cal U struggled to find their rhythm, ending the match with a hitting percentage of .000. 

Notably, IUP's performance peaked in the second set, where they hit an impressive .344 with 17 kills.

Individually, Jessica led the team with 12 kills and added two blocks, while Simay Memisoglu followed closely with 11 kills and two blocks of her own, hitting .321. Charlotte Potvin posted eight kills and Olivia Heidel had another big night racking in 37 assists. Leading the blocks for IUP was Rylee Brown posting three on the night.
